Skip to content

SpecForgeDer MCP-Server, der deiner KI strukturiertes Gedächtnis gibt

Du musst kein Experte sein — aber Experten lieben ihn auch. Läuft auf Mac, Windows und Linux. Verbindet sich mit Claude, Cursor, Windsurf, Gemini CLI und mehr. Kein API-Schlüssel. Kein Konto. Installation in 2 Minuten.

macOS
Windows
Linux

Kompatibel mit Ihrem gesamten Ökosystem

Ein MCP-Server. Jeder KI-Agent. Jede Programmiersprache.

Claude
ChatGPT
Cursor
Windsurf
Gemini
GitHub Copilot
VS Code
Claude
ChatGPT
Cursor
Windsurf
Gemini
GitHub Copilot
VS Code
TypeScript
Python
Go
Rust
Swift
Kotlin
PHP
Ruby
C#
Dart
Flutter
React
Next.js
TypeScript
Python
Go
Rust
Swift
Kotlin
PHP
Ruby
C#
Dart
Flutter
React
Next.js

Welches Problem löst es?

Beim Softwareentwickeln mit einem KI-Assistenten stößt man immer wieder auf dieselben Probleme:

  • Die KI vergisst mitten im Prozess, was du gebaut hast
  • Du beschreibst dieselbe Funktion 3 Mal in verschiedenen Chats
  • Der Code endet anders als du es dir ursprünglich vorgestellt hast
  • Du weißt nicht, ob die Funktion "fertig" oder nur "irgendwie fertig" ist

SpecForge löst all das. Es gibt deiner KI ein organisiertes Gedächtnis darüber, was gebaut werden soll, wie es gebaut werden soll und wie geprüft wird, dass es korrekt fertiggestellt wurde — damit du immer die Kontrolle behältst.


So funktioniert es — 4 Schritte

1. Teile SpecForge mit, was du bauen möchtest

"Erstelle eine Spec für das Hinzufügen von Google-Login zu meinem Projekt"

SpecForge stellt die nötigen Fragen und generiert eine Spec — ein kurzes Dokument mit einem schrittweisen Plan und einer Checkliste, was "fertig" bedeutet.

2. Deine KI folgt der Spec

Die Spec wird zur Entwicklungsvereinbarung. Deine KI liest sie, folgt ihr und überprüft die Arbeit automatisch.

3. Validiere, wenn du fertig bist

"Validiere Spec SPEC-001 gegen meinen Code unter /pfad/zu/projekt"

SpecForge sagt dir genau, welche Punkte der Liste erledigt sind, welche fehlen und was sich gegenüber dem ursprünglichen Plan geändert hat (wir nennen das "Drift" — wenn der Code nicht mehr zum ursprünglichen Plan passt).

4. Deployiere mit Vertrauen

Jeder Plan wird gespeichert und versioniert. Jede Änderung wird festgehalten. Du kennst immer den tatsächlichen Status deines Projekts.


Schnellinstallation

Voraussetzung: Node.js ≥ 22 (hier herunterladen). Keine API-Schlüssel. Keine Konten. Alle Daten bleiben lokal.

Der Konfigurationsblock ist für alle Agenten gleich — nur der Dateipfad unterscheidet sich:

json
{
  "mcpServers": {
    "specforge": {
      "command": "npx",
      "args": ["-y", "specforge-mcp@latest"]
    }
  }
}

Claude Desktop

1. Claude Desktop öffnen → Menü ClaudeEinstellungen → Tab EntwicklerKonfiguration bearbeiten

2. Den obigen Konfigurationsblock innerhalb von "mcpServers" einfügen, speichern und Claude Desktop neu starten.

Claude Code — 1 Befehl

bash
claude mcp add specforge -- npx -y specforge-mcp@latest

Cursor

~/.cursor/mcp.json öffnen oder erstellen, den Konfigurationsblock einfügen und Cursor neu starten.

Windsurf

~/.codeium/windsurf/mcp_config.json öffnen oder erstellen, den Konfigurationsblock einfügen und Windsurf neu starten.

Gemini CLI

~/.gemini/settings.json öffnen oder erstellen, den Konfigurationsblock einfügen und Gemini CLI neu starten.

ChatGPT Desktop

Öffne oder erstelle die Konfigurationsdatei unter:

  • Mac: ~/Library/Application Support/ChatGPT/config.json
  • Windows: %APPDATA%\ChatGPT\config.json

Füge den Konfigurationsblock in "mcpServers" ein, speichere und starte ChatGPT neu. Erfordert ChatGPT Plus oder Pro.

Cline (VS Code-Erweiterung)

In VS Code mit installiertem Cline: Cline-Seitenleiste öffnen → MCP Servers klicken → Block einfügen. Cline →

Vollständige Anleitung mit Beispielen →


Für wen ist es?

Ich bin...SpecForge hilft mir...
Ein Solo-Entwickler, der Claude nutztMeine KI fokussiert zu halten und mich nicht zwischen Sitzungen zu wiederholen
Ein Entwickler, der neu bei KI-Tools istStrukturierte, professionelle Specs zu erhalten, ohne zu wissen, wie man sie schreibt
Ein Tech Lead oder ArchitektStandards durchzusetzen, Abweichungen zu erkennen und das Team ausgerichtet zu halten
Ein FreelancerZu dokumentieren, was ich für Kunden gebaut habe, und frühzeitig Scope-Creep zu erkennen
Ein Student, der programmieren lerntProfessionelle Entwicklungspraktiken zu erlernen, während KI-Tools verwendet werden

Alle 59 Tools ansehen →


59 Tools. 8 Streams.

StreamWas es macht
A — KonfigurationProjekt einrichten, damit SpecForge versteht, was du baust
B — PlanungFeature-Pläne (Specs) erstellen, aktualisieren und verwalten
C — AnalyseAufwand schätzen, Qualität prüfen, erkennen wann Code vom Plan abweicht
D — DesignDatenbank-Design, UI-Verträge, Entscheidungsprotokoll und Ausführungspläne
E — Stack & AgentenTool-Vorschläge, Versions-Checks, benutzerdefinierte KI-Fähigkeiten generieren
F — AuslieferungTests, Dokumentation und Tool-Vorschläge generieren, Projektmanagement verbinden
G — InfrastrukturGit-Integration, mehrere KI-Agenten parallel betreiben, gemeinsamen Kontext verwalten
H — GovernanceAbhängigkeiten prüfen, veraltete Pakete erkennen, Datenschutz-Compliance

Vollständige Tools-Referenz ansehen →